    Where to find Lavender Albino Balls

    I have been looking everywhere and haven't found one place that is selling juvenile Lavenders. I was wondering what the prices are on them also.. Any help would be greatly appreciated

    Re: Where to find Lavender Albino Balls

    Quote Originally Posted by creativecorns View Post
    I have been looking everywhere and haven't found one place that is selling juvenile Lavenders. I was wondering what the prices are on them also.. Any help would be greatly appreciated
    Now is not the best time to find them. In a few months you should see quite a few. Not sure what the price will be this year. I would bet they will be advertized in the $2500 - $3000 range.
